This episode will tackle how infrastructure operators and investors can ensure that infrastructure assets are accessible, inclusive, and equitable for all users. How can we reconcile the pursuit of economic growth with the imperative of inclusivity, ensuring that infrastructure serves all members of society equitably? Moreover, what role do responsible business models and innovative investment strategies play in navigating these complex challenges, and how can stakeholders align financial objectives with social and environmental responsibilities? Join us as we navigate these pressing issues and explore innovative pathways towards building infrastructure that not only connects communities but also fosters social cohesion.

In this podcast Matthew Bishop (The Economist U.S. Business Editor and New York Bureau Chief) interviews Sébastien Petithuguenin (Paprec CEO), Simon Whistler (PRI Head of real assets), Prof. Dr. Bryan T. Adey (Professor at ETH Zurich), to discuss how can infrastructure stakeholders transition towards responsible business models to ensure inclusivity in infrastructure development.
